Who are we?

Picture
The Hijabi Ballers project, based in the Greater Toronto Area, seeks to recognize and celebrate the athleticism of Muslim girls and women. Through our programs, we also work to increase participation, and consequently representation, of Muslim females in sport spaces and sports programs around the city.

The name Hijabi Ballers represents three things: being a female of Muslim faith, being an athlete, and being a boss. The project is meant to shine light on those who visibly represent their faith while portraying themselves as athletes, in the urban diaspora. The word 'baller', an umbrella term for all athletes and holds a strong connotation of being a boss, being successful and being bold. A Hijabi Baller is a Muslim female athlete who is proud of her intersectional identity.




Our Goals:

1. Increase representation of Muslim females in Toronto’s sport spaces and sport media
2. Provide opportunities for Muslim females to participate in sport, try new sports and hone their skills
3. Recognize the accomplishments of and celebrate Muslim female athletes
4. Integrate allies (i.e coaches, parents, community mentors) in the growth of Muslim females in the sport space
